The Estwing Rock Pick is a premium 22 oz geology hammer forged from a single piece of solid steel, featuring a patented shock-reduction vinyl grip and a genuine leather handle for superior comfort and durability. Designed for both hammering and precise rock cracking, it’s the trusted tool of geologists and contractors worldwide, proudly made in the USA since 1923.

This is a great tool that will last forever if you take the time to do as another reviewer suggested for the Estwing Sportsman’s Axe and sand off the varnish on the handle. It’s a clear shellac that will inevitably crack and the first thing you need to do after removing all the stickers is to get the factory varnish off. I’m so glad to have found the description for how to do this that I decided to write a review for the rock hammer in order to share it: First you want to tape off the metal part of the handle and use 100 grit sand paper to completely sand off the varnish on the grip (it will become lighter in color as you sand). Then rub neatsfoot oil on the leather multiple times daily until it stops soaking in. (It takes about 3-4 days and several coats of oil.) For a more detailed description of the process look for A. Swenson’s review for the 14” Sportsman Axe called “This is the real deal!” (Definitely worth reading, it’s a much better explanation of the process than what I’ve provided here.) Admittedly this is a bit of extra work for something you just purchased but if you’re like me and frequently customizing your tools, it’s actually pretty enjoyable. Lighter fluid works well for removing stubborn adhesive left over from the stickers and I used steel wool to polish out any scratches. I purchased this rock hammer after buying the axe and both have held up great with the sanding & oil process! I don’t expect to need another one in my lifetime, and I really enjoy the look and feel of this model compared to others out there.
